* 4 First Aid Measures


· Description of first aid measures
· General information: No special measures required.
· After inhalation: Supply fresh air; consult doctor if symptoms persist.
· After skin contact:
Wash with water and soap.
If skin irritation continues, consult a doctor.
· After eye contact:
Rinse opened eye for several minutes under running water and consult a doctor.
· After swallowing:
Rinse the mouth with water.
If swallowed, do not induce vomiting: seek medical advice immediately and show this container or
label.
· Most important symptoms and effects, both acute and delayed
No further relevant information available.
· Indication of any immediate medical attention and special treatment needed
Treat symptomatically.

* 5 Fire Fighting Measures


· Extinguishing media
· Suitable extinguishing agents:
Carbon dioxide
Fire-extinguishing powder
Water spray
Use fire extinguishing methods suitable to surrounding conditions.
· For safety reasons unsuitable extinguishing agents: Not applicable.
· Special hazards arising from the substance or mixture
Formation of toxic gases is possible during heating or in case of fire.
· Advice for firefighters
· Protective equipment:
Wear self-contained respiratory protective device.
Wear fully protective suit.
· Additional information
Dispose of fire debris and contaminated fire fighting water in accordance with official regulations.

· Material of gloves
Nitrile rubber, NBR
The selection of the suitable gloves does not only depend on the material, but also on further marks
of quality and varies from manufacturer to manufacturer. As the product is a preparation of several
substances, the resistance of the glove material can not be calculated in advance and has
therefore to be checked prior to the application.
· Eye protection: Goggles recommended during refilling
· Body protection: Wear protective clothing.
· Limitation and supervision of exposure into the environment Avoid release to the environment.
